> Anita Cohen-Williams set up HISTARCH about 25 years ago. For all those 
> years she has quietly moderated and administered the email list. We 
> are all deeply indebted to her for her service.
>
> All those years ago, Anita set up the list at Arizona State University.
> Earlier this week, after an administrative change, the ASU systems 
> administrators deleted the list and its archive. There was no faculty 
> or staff member that "owned" the list.
>
> After some initial panic, two ASU faculty stepped in to help resolve 
> the problem. We are indebted to  Drs. Peeples and Barton for their 
> help. The list was subsequently restored.
>
> Anita is working to migrate the list membership and archive to a new 
> host, which will hopefully last for another 25 years and last as a 
> permanent archive.
